It has already been established, although my Department retains the economic migration policy function, which is important because we deal with industry, enterprise and business. The Departments of Foreign Affairs and Justice, Equality and Law Reform have already come together and we now work with that group. INIS is the name of the group, and its fundamental objective is to make it more effective and efficient for the individuals, companies and all concerned.

Recent changes to work permits mean the Minister for Justice, Equality and Law Reform will allow the spouses of work permit holders to also apply to come in. If they are above the family income supplement——
